Pakistani minister hurt, seven killed in suicide bombing

A suicide attacker detonated a bomb at a public meeting in north-western Pakistan today, killing at least seven people and wounding Pakistan’s interior minister, police said.

The bomb exploded when Interior Minister Aftab Khan Sherpao had finished his speech at the meeting in Charsadda, said Mohammed Khan, a police official. He said at least 10 people were in critical condition.
